A lightweight DLNA/UPnP AV MediaRenderer (DMR) written in Go for macOS.
It announces itself on your LAN, accepts external cast/control requests from DLNA control points, and plays media via IINA.
Includes session ownership (single-controller at a time) and optional system volume linkage.
Features
SSDP discovery as MediaRenderer
UPnP services
AVTransport: SetAVTransportURI, Play, Pause, Stop, Seek, and status queries
Uses iina-cli if available, otherwise starts the IINA app binary
Controls playback through mpv JSON IPC
Normalizes the eight-step Douyin iOS volume control to IINA's full range
Session ownership
Single active controller per session
Configurable preemption policy
Optional macOS system volume linkage (via AppleScript, darwin only)
Per-installation UUID persistence for stable, collision-free discovery identity

Configuration
Environment variables include:
DMR_HTTP_PORT: HTTP listen port (default 8200)
DMR_ADVERTISE_IP: IPv4 address to advertise on multi-homed or VPN-connected Macs
DMR_ALLOW_PREEMPT: allow a new controller to take the active session
DMR_LINK_SYSTEM_VOLUME: mirror renderer volume to macOS system volume
